What are some of the notable features or innovations incorporated into this product that consumers should be excited about?
Our Freddo Espresso Transforming Body Scrub literally does what it says, and… it is a market first! I’m so proud of this innovative formula that transforms from a scrub into a body serum! Of course you can use this product in the usual scrub on/rinse off way, however the way I would really like you to use the product is after you have showered (or bathed) and dried off. Take your time to massage the super fine coffee and olive seed scrub into your body, starting at your ankles and working upwards in sweeping circular motions – savor this time for yourself. As you are taking this time the serum will absorb into your skin, then using a towel or our Body Sweep brush off the polishing coffee and olive seeds to reveal nourished and hydrated skin. This method ensures that your skin gets the maximum benefits from the nourishing ingredients.

Can you tell us about the key ingredients and formulations used in Lilian Muir products?
At Lillian Muir, we pride ourselves on our biomimetic formulations that capture the essence of Mediterranean life, blending tradition with cutting-edge science to create products that truly nourish and transform the skin. Each ingredient is carefully selected to work synergistically, providing a luxurious and effective skincare experience. Our formulations are designed not only to address specific skin concerns but also to deliver the timeless beauty and tranquility of Mediterranean life to your daily routine.
Freddo Espresso Transforming Body Scrub:
- Pomegranate Extract: Rich in vitamin C, folic acid, and polyphenols, pomegranate extract promotes a youthful appearance and shields the skin from environmental stressors. Its free radical scavenging and anti-inflammatory properties are essential for maintaining healthy, radiant skin.
- Coffea Arabica (Coffee) Seed: Finely ground coffee seeds exfoliate the skin while invigorating it with natural caffeine. This ingredient, enriched with vitamins B3 and E, tightens and nourishes the skin, promoting elasticity and helping to protect against external damage.
- Olive Stones: The fine particles of olive stones reduce skin irregularities by exfoliating and removing impurities. This helps regulate skin texture, resulting in a healthier and more radiant appearance.
- Coenzyme A: This powerful ingredient stimulates the catabolism of lipids, aiding in the reduction of cellulite and improving uneven skin texture. It ensures the skin remains smooth and firm.
- Crithmum Maritimum Extract (Sea Fennel): Rich in vitamins and minerals, sea fennel extract is known for its hydrating and anti-aging properties. It enhances skin texture and tone, encourages collagen production, and supports the skin’s natural renewal process.
- Biotin (Vitamin B7): Essential for maintaining skin health, biotin helps keep the skin hydrated and promotes the production of new, healthy skin cells, improving overall complexion.
Whipped Body Cream:
- Punica Granatum (Pomegranate) Fruit Extract: As in our body scrub, pomegranate extract offers powerful antioxidant protection, nourishing and protecting the skin while promoting regeneration.
- Oryza Sativa (Rice) Bran Oil: This oil is packed with antioxidants, including vitamin E, ferulic acid, and oryzanol. It moisturizes the skin, provides UV protection, and helps prevent premature aging by neutralizing free radicals.
- Bisabolol: Derived from chamomile, bisabolol is celebrated for its skin-soothing properties. It reduces inflammation, provides hydration, and has antimicrobial benefits, protecting the skin from potential irritants.
- Beta-Glucan: A powerful skin-soother, beta-glucan reduces redness and other signs of sensitive skin. It also boasts excellent moisturizing properties, enhancing the skin’s barrier function and reducing the appearance of wrinkles.
- Ceramides: Crucial for maintaining the skin’s barrier function, ceramides lock in moisture and protect against environmental aggressors. They are key to keeping the skin hydrated and plump.
